请问一个关于URL中汉字编码解码的问题

2024-11-02 19:07:25
推荐回答(4个)
回答1:

URLDecoder.decode(url, "utf-8");
url是你的地行郑址,
解码完之后,接收一下。应该可以了。
编码之后,记得解码。
import java.net.URLDecoder;
一个解码,森蠢
import java.net.URLEncoder;
一个编码。
如果遇到无法解码,在页面上将%替换成!
URLEncoder.encode(input,"UTF-8").replaceAll("%","!"),
然后在后台,再转换回来,String的档春颂replaceAll("!","%")。

回答2:

new String(teststr.getBate(,"ISO-8859-1"),"UTF-8");
所噶。

回答3:

页启腊面编码是简体源并中文的,GB2312,我改成UTF-8整个页面就是乱码了~
两种编码要一致的,我调试网页时悄裂滑就是这样

回答4:

那楼主看看你选择的浏览器编码是UTF-8还是其他的。
查看-字符编码